WebSun Yee On (Chinese: 新義安), or the New Righteousness and Peace Commercial and Industrial Guild, is one of the leading triads in Hong Kong and China. It has more than 25,000 members worldwide. It is also believed to be active in the UK, the United States, France, and Belgium. According to the Daily Mail, the database was initially leaked to the Inter-Parliamentary Alliance on China (IPAC) in September by … inclination\\u0027s 2vTriad, a China-based criminal organization, secret association, or club, was a branch of the secret Hung Society, a secret society formed with the intent of overthrowing the then ruling Qing Dynasty. Triads therefore first began as part of an organised patriotic movement to overthrow Qing rule which was considered tyrannical and foreign to the Han ethnic majority since the Qing dynasty was composed of ethnic Manchus.
